recarter at adelphia.net wrote:
> I recently completed my K2. I assume that it has the very latest
> firmware. Although it works fine with k2Remote, it doesn't work
> reliably with any third-party software that I've tried. I've tried
> the latest version of dxLab commander, HamRadioDelux, and even
> purchased HamStationExtreme. Comander won't even connect with the
> K2. HRD keeps stalling when updating the frequency display.
I've used HRD and N4PY as well as various contest logging programs with
absolutely no problems. Are you using a real serial port on your
computer or a USB-to-serial adapter? Some of these adapters do not work
properly in this application.
I would agree with W3FPR that the place to look for the problem is on
the computer end. A hardware problem in the K2 would probably prevent
it from working with K2Remote, and too many people are using these other
programs successfully to implicate the K2 firmware.
